#7dbda3 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7dbda3 is composed of 49% red, 74.1% green and 63.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 33.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.8%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 155.6 degrees, a saturation of 32.7% and a lightness of 61.6%. #7dbda3 color hex could be obtained by blending #faffff with #007b47.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

#7dbda3 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#7dbda3 has RGB values of R:125, G:189, B:163 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0, Y:0.14,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 8240547.

Hex triplet 7dbda3 #7dbda3
RGB Decimal 125, 189, 163 rgb(125,189,163)
RGB Percent 49, 74.1, 63.9 rgb(49%,74.1%,63.9%)
CMYK 34, 0, 14, 26
HSL 155.6°, 32.7, 61.6 hsl(155.6,32.7%,61.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 155.6°, 33.9, 74.1
Web Safe 66cc99 #66cc99
CIE-LAB 71.824, -26.197, 6.679
XYZ 33.264, 43.398, 41.272
xyY 0.282, 0.368, 43.398
CIE-LCH 71.824, 27.035, 165.697
CIE-LUV 71.824, -30.978, 14.031
Hunter-Lab 65.877, -25.153, 8.969
Binary 01111101, 10111101, 10100011

Shades and Tints of #7dbda3

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f2f8f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7dbda3

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9b9f9d is the less saturated color, while #41f9ae is the most saturated one.
